description | Development of in vitro methods to propagate rubber is highly desirable.
Some procedures exist but they generally do not address well the initial and
establishment stages. This leads to minimal arrest of two common deterrents in any
micropropagation system, i.e., contamination and browning. This project attempted
to study both contamination and browning phenomena with an aim of improving
survival without altering regeneration of explants.
Field materials of clone RRIM 600 were used. Experiments on the Initial and
Establishment stages, their interactions and concluding experiments were conducted.
In all experiments, explants were cultured in the standard tissue culture procedures
on basic MS medium.
In the Initial stage, the results showed no significant difference between
chemical treatments of antibiotics and/or fungicide in the field and control. As for the
physical characteristics, efficient initial measures were to use 6-week old middle
portions or shoot tips. This could be improved by growing these explants in a
glasshouse.
In the Establishment stage, the most efficient procedure to decontaminate
explants was Procedure E that included a succession of treatments with ethanol,
Clorox, Rifampicin, Ampicillin, DMSO and Triton-X before culturing. Regarding
debrowning treatments, the best overall responses were obtained by culturing
explants in MS medium (half strength) modified by the addition of 4 mg/L silver
nitrate.
In the analysis of the interactions between treatments in the Initial and
Establishment stages, results showed that the combination of treatments with better
potential was the one that included the use of mature explants (6-week old) surface decontaminated
by Procedure E. |
